Pay to Win is subject to interpretation.

Yes you get money faster with premium subs/founders mechs, Yes if you want a particular weapon or mech you can spend real money on it. By most people definition this does not make a game pay to win as there is nothing you are getting that a non-paying player cannot get. You are paying to get things faster not to get better things.

Honestly if your definition on "pay to win" is that no player can pay to get something at a quicker rate you should stop looking at free to play games all together because I have yet to see one that does not offer the option to pay to unlock content faster.

Most people consider "pay to win" to mean you have to spend real money to get something that is better (gives an in combat advantage) than what a free player can get without ever spending money.
